In residential Mayflower Village, the question we hear most from homeowners runs something like this: “Do you actually pull permits here?” The answer is yes, and it matters more in Mayflower Village than almost anywhere else in the San Gabriel Valley. The community is an unincorporated pocket of Los Angeles County wedged between Arcadia and Monrovia, so every driveway replacement, paver patio, or concrete pour routes through LA County’s Building and Safety division, not a city building department. That changes timelines, fee schedules, and which inspector shows up at your door. We’ve navigated that process hundreds of times. Paver Driveways
Paver driveways in Mayflower Village run from roughly $7,000 to $18,000, depending on square footage, paver type, and whether we’re working around the original 1950s ranch-home footprint. Most homes here were built between the late 1940s and the 1960s, and the original driveways often sit on compacted native soil that needs proper base work before pavers go down. We carry Belgard and Techo-Bloc products you can look up by name, and we don’t skimp on the base layer because that’s the difference between a driveway that still looks level in ten years and one that shifts after the first heavy rain.

Driveway Repair & Replacement
Driveway replacement in Mayflower Village ranges from $5,000 to $14,000, depending on whether we’re hauling out an old concrete slab, repairing the base beneath, or converting from one material to another. We see a lot of original 60-year-old concrete driveways with deep cracking and settling around the edges. LA County inspectors will ask about drainage, and so will we. Proper slope and runoff matter here because Mayflower Village sits at the base of the San Gabriel Mountain foothills, and water moves fast when it rains. A driveway that drains toward the house is a future foundation problem.

Common Driveway & Pavers Problems We See in Mayflower Village Homes
- Cracked and heaved concrete from post-war construction: Many homes in the 91006 ZIP code still have their original 1950s concrete driveways, and the native soil beneath them expands and contracts with seasonal moisture. The result is cracking, level shifts, and edges that chip away.
- Poor drainage after decades of settling: Because Mayflower Village sits at the foot of the San Gabriels, even modest rainfall moves quickly across the surface. Driveways that once drained adequately can start sending water toward the home after years of gradual settling.
- Paver base failure from previous installations: We regularly replace paver driveways that were installed by out-of-area crews who didn’t compact or excavate deeply enough. In Mayflower Village’s soil, the base layer matters more than the pavers themselves.
- Fire-hazard-zone compliance issues: When a driveway replacement is part of a larger remodel or addition, the County’s Chapter 7A standards for the Very High Fire Hazard Severity Zone can trigger additional requirements around material choices and site access. A contractor unfamiliar with Mayflower Village’s unincorporated status often misses this entirely.
